Croquet set consisting of 4 mallets, 3 balls, 2 pegs, 4 hoops, and a box with lid. The mallets have painted heads (blue, orange, red, green) with a glossy finish. The balls are turned wood. Two of the balls are the same size (red, yellow), and the third is smaller (red). The pegs are red and green and turned to have a flat end for resting on a flat surface. The hoops are made of wire that is bent into U-shapes at the ends for resting on a flat surface. The blue box lid is printed with an illustration of children playing croquet in a domestic interior with the label, "PARLOR CROQUET SET", across the top.Context
Made by Newton & Thompson Manufacturing Company in Brandon, VTAcquisition
